BLOCKING DEVICE FOR A TIMEPIECE
Disclosed is a timepiece blocking device including first and second mobile parts kinematically connected to one another, the first mobile part including a drive device, the second mobile part including a stopping device; a rotating drive member turning in a single direction and cooperating with the drive device to displace the first mobile part, and thus the second mobile part, alternately in opposite directions; and a rotating blocking member tensioned and cooperating with the stopping device to be blocked by the second mobile part and released at determined times by the displacements of the second mobile part. Cooperation between the rotating blocking member and stopping device immobilizes the mobile parts when the rotating drive member does not cooperate with the drive device. In normal operation, the rotating drive member contacts the first mobile part only when cooperating with the drive device, i.e. over less than 60% of one revolution of the rotating drive member.
Mechanical horological movement provided with an escapement comprising an anchor
The horological movement includes a mechanical resonator and an escapement including an escapement wheel, which has a plurality of teeth, and an anchor formed by a stick and two arms having respectively two mechanical pallets likely to come into contact, when the anchor is subject to an alternative movement, with any of the teeth according to the angular position of the escapement wheel. To avoid damage to the escapement during rocking of the anchor while the escapement wheel is positioned in an unfavourable angular position, the anchor is arranged, during the rocking of this anchor, to be able to bend being subjected to an elastic deformation. The anchor has an elastic capacity between each of the two mechanical pallets and a fork of the anchor, enabling it to absorb elastically, during the elastic deformation, a maximum mechanical energy that the mechanical resonator can have during the normal functioning of the horological movement.

Timepiece escapement mechanism
Disclosed is an escapement mechanism (1) for a timepiece, designed to cooperate with an oscillator arranged to carry out oscillations, said mechanism (1) comprising:a count wheel (7) arranged for step-wise forward rotation depending on the oscillations of the oscillator;an impulse wheel (11) designed to be kinematically linked to a power source, said impulse wheel (11) being arranged to be periodically blocked and released under the control of the count wheel (7) and to supply impulses to the oscillator, characterized in that:when said escapement mechanism (1) is operating, the count wheel (7) is continuously subjected to a torque;and the count wheel (7) is arranged to rotate forward by one half-step of its toothing for every vibration of the oscillator.

Escapement system and measuring device comprising said escapement system
The present invention relates to an escapement system that can be used, for example, in a measuring device such as in a timepiece. The escapement system comprises a drive axle and at least one escape wheel that has at least one impulse tooth. The at least one impulse tooth is connected to the drive axle via at least one spring element and has a starting position in which it is fixed such that the spring element has a preload torque.

Safety regulation for a timepiece escapement
Mechanism for regulating energy to achieve the function of a timepiece mechanism including a functional mobile component, controlling a dissipation of energy through eddy currents in the event of racing by this mobile component, including a magnetically permeable or magnetized rotor kinematically connected to this mobile component, and a magnetized or respectively magnetically permeable stator, facing this rotor in an annular area where these eddy currents develop, this rotor and this stator are external to each other, this rotor and/or this stator including an alternation of raised areas where it can move into superposition with the other in an interaction generating eddy currents, and hollow areas in which it cannot move into superposition with the other. Escapement mechanism including such a regulating mechanism, limiting the effect of accelerations on an escape wheel.

TIMEPIECE ESCAPEMENT DEVICE AND OPERATING METHOD OF SUCH A DEVICE
The invention relates to an escapement device (400) comprising a first escapement wheel (1), a second escapement wheel (2), and a brake-lever (3), said second escapement wheel being disposed between the first escapement wheel and the brake-lever, in particular the second escapement wheel coming into contact and engaging with both the first escapement wheel and the brake-lever.
